Essential Devices Every Workplace Need To Have For Effective Manual Handling
Manual handling entails numerous jobs, consisting of lifting, pressing, pulling, bring, or moving items by hand or physical pressure. The effectiveness and safety and security of these actions can be considerably improved with the right devices and training.
Here's a better look at some important devices:
1. Lifting Equipment
1.1 Forklifts
Forklifts are important in warehouses and producing setups where heavy products require to be relocated rapidly and successfully. They decrease physical strain on employees.

1.2 Pallet Jacks
Pallet jacks are best for relocating palletized goods around the office with ease. They come in handbook and electric variations satisfying different needs.
1.3 Hoists
Hoists assist lift heavy things up and down with minimal human initiative. They are specifically helpful in settings where objects need to be raised from heights.
2. Individual Protective Equipment (PPE)
2.1 Safety Gloves
Wearing handwear covers can supply hold while securing hands from cuts and abrasions when taking care of sharp or harsh First Aid training Perth materials.
2.2 Steel-Toed Boots
These boots protect feet from dropping objects and give far better grip on unsafe surfaces.
2.3 Back Assistance Belts
Back support belts can help remind workers to maintain correct position while lifting.

4. Ergonomic Tools
4.1 Adjustable Workstations
These permit workers to alter their working height according to their comfort level which lessens pressure during repeated tasks.
4.2 Ergonomic Raising Devices
Tools like flexible hoists or lifts developed specifically for ergonomic usage can considerably minimize the threat of injury.

5. Proper Storage Solutions
5.1 Shelving Units
Sturdy shelving devices assist maintain products off the ground at waistline elevation, reducing the requirement for extreme flexing or reaching.
5.2 Storage Containers and Containers
Properly identified storage remedies make discovering things less complicated without unneeded searching that can lead to awkward lifting positions.
